Planning a trip to the enchanting country of France? Before you pack your bags, you'll need to acquire a French visa. The application process may seem complex, but with careful preparation and these step-by-step instructions, you can navigate it with ease.

First, determine the type of visa needed for your trip. Are you going to France for tourism, work? Each visa category has specific requirements.

  • After that, collect all the necessary documents, including your copyright, recent photographs, documentation of financial means, and a accurate application form.
  • File your application along with the required documents to the French embassy or consulate in your location.
  • Anticipate to attend an interview as part of the application process. This is where you'll address questions about your trip and prove your eligibility for a visa.

Following the review of your application and interview, you'll receive a decision on your visa. If approved, you'll be granted a visa that allows you to enter France.

Obtaining a French Tourist copyright

Applying for a French tourist copyright is a easy process. You can make your application through the official website of the French embassy. Before submitting your application, make sure you have all the essential documents, such as a valid copyright, proof of travel arrangements, and a statement of purpose for your trip. You will also need to furnish a visa fee online. Once your application is processed, you will get an email with further instructions.

The processing time for a French tourist visa can vary depending on website the applicant's nationality and the volume of applications. It is advised that you apply for your visa at least a few weeks in advance of your planned trip to France. To ensure a smooth application process, it is important to carefully review the application requirements and instructions on the French embassy website.
